DUTERTE ALLIES LAUNCH RAGE COALITION, BACK VP SARA’S 2028 BID

Supporters of the family of former President Rodrigo Duterte gathered on Sunday, April 12, at Club Filipino to formally launch the Reform Alliance for Good Governance (RAGE) Coalition.

The coalition, led by Davao City Mayor Baste Duterte, aims to unite multi-sector groups and stakeholders under a common cause: to fight for truth, uphold good governance, and demand accountability.

The launch came a day after Sebastian Duterte was named president of Partido Demokratiko Pilipino–Lakas ng Bayan (PDP-Laban), the political party once led by his father.

Among those present were Senators Robin Padilla and Christopher “Bong” Go, former Anakalusugan Party-list Representative Mike Defensor, Batangas 1st District Representative Leandro Leviste, former House Speaker Pantaleon Alvarez, and former Executive Secretary Vic Rodriguez.

The timing of the coalition’s unveiling coincides with the upcoming House Committee on Justice hearing on Tuesday, April 14, where Ramil Madriaga—a confessed bagman of Vice President Sara Duterte—is expected to testify in the impeachment proceedings.

Vice President Duterte’s camp has petitioned the Supreme Court of the Philippines to halt the hearings, but with no temporary restraining order issued, the House has decided to proceed.

Senator Ronald “Bato” dela Rosa, who has been absent from Senate sessions since November 2025, expressed support for the coalition in a televised statement.

“Hindi tayo papayag na gamitin ang politika para patahimikin ang mga lider na tunay na naglilingkod sa bayan. Ang laban na ito ay hindi lamang para sa iilan, ito ay laban para sa bawat Pilipino na naghahangad ng maayos na pamahalaan, makatarungang sistema at may magandang kinabukasan,” Dela Rosa said.

The coalition also declared its backing for Vice President Sara Duterte’s presidential bid in the 2028 elections.
